Although the issue of low psychiatric recruitment has been discussed in a variety of studies but the issue has not been systematically reviewed especially for the UK context. We therefore conducted a systematic review of literature published from 1974 onwards using four electronic databases: Medline, EMBASE, CINAHL, and PsycINFO. Searches were based on keywords associated with psychiatry trainees/students, doctors and attitude.
The results showed that negative attitudes and stigma toward psychiatry pose significant obstacles to recruitment. The results suggest that the training and teaching of psychiatry need to be re-examined and improved in order to draw medical students and trainees to the field. Specific enrichment activities, such as research in psychiatry and the university psychiatry club, summer schools,46, psychiatry electives and a special study module, could be effective at changing student perceptions and enhancing recruitment.

The lack of number of trainees in psychiatry is recognized as a significant issue across the globe. Few studies have examined the reasons for this decline. In this study, our aim was to examine the literature in a systematic manner on the factors influencing admission into the field of psychiatry. We searched four databases and included 27 articles in the final analysis.
Our findings suggest that enrichment programs are important in attracting students to the field of psychiatry. These include role models and opportunities for students to shadow experts. These factors are important because they influence the recruitment of females. We discovered that stigma and negative attitudes towards psychiatry were a barrier to gaining admission. These obstacles are likely due to a lack of understanding of what psychiatry is. We conclude that the current teaching and training of psychiatry are in need of significant changes in order to attract students and change their perceptions.
